23.10.2021 news Oyo Prison Attackers Broke Fence With Grenades, Killed Amotekun Officer

Published 23rd Oct, 2021

By Gabriel Ogunjobi

An officer of the Amotekun security outfit identified as Babatunde Tijani was shot dead when gunmen attacked Abolongo Correctional Centre, Oyo State, at about 10 pm on Friday, FIJ can report.

Olayinka Olayanju, commandant of the Amotekun Corps in the state, confirmed this to our reporter, adding that the family of the deceased had been briefed on the unfortunate incident.

FIJ further gathered that the attackers facilitated the escape of some inmates after dismantling the fence of the prison using hand grenades.

Earlier, Olanrewaju Anjorin, the Public Relations Officer, Oyo State Command of the Nigeria Correctional Service, told journalists that the command’s controller had gone with other senior officers to the scene.

“They are assessing the situation, looking at the damage done to the facility. A detailed report will be made known later,” he said.
